We are aware of this recent change introduced by Google Maps. This “callback” in the URL parameters is now mandatory, but the point is that on the 99% of the WordPress websites, this would actually fail to be called, and other, different, JavaScript errors would be raised. What you see in the console is actually a log raised by Google, but invoking a function during a callback when this function is not ready yet (maybe due to lazy-loading techniques of JS assets) would mean generating a real JavaScript error that may harm the rest of the website.

Our programmers will analyse the situation better, because Vik Booking does not need Google Maps to invoke a callback to render the actual map. It was definitely better if this param was left optional by Google, and this may change again in a near update for Google Maps.
